Sensitivity of computed uranium-238 self-shielding factors to the choice of the unresolved average resonance parameters

The influence of different representations of the unresolved resonances of 238U on the computed self-shielding factors is examined. It is shown that the evaluated infinitely diluted average capture cross section does not provide sufficient information to determine a unique set of unresolved resonance parameters; different sets of unresolved resonance parameters equally consistent with the evaluated average capture cross section yield significantly different computed self-shielding factors. In the conclusion it is recommended that the resolved resonance description of the evaluated 238U cross sections be extended to higher energies and that thick sample transmission data and self-indication data be used to improve the evaluation of the unresolved resonance region
